生成默认的layout文件:
doxygen -l
设置不显示头文件的源码:
VERBATIM_HEADERS = NO
设置输入的目录:
INPUT = ./tee
设置图片的目录:
IMAGE_PATH = ./tee/img
设置Layout文件目录:
LAYOUT_FILE = xxx_layout.xml
设置C语言优化:
OPTIMIZE_OUTPUT_FOR_C = YES
设置图标:
PROJECT_LOGO = ./common/xxx_icon.png
在markdown中使用doxygen命令:
@addtogroup xxx Framework API
在markdown中做页内跳转:
<a href=”#1″>111</a>
#### <a name=”1″>xxx Architecture</a> ####
缩进:
>
>>
原点号:
*
让Latex支持中文:
sudo apt-get install latex-cjk-all
2) 用文本编辑器打开docxygen生成的latex目录中的refman.tex。找到“\begin{document}”这一行,将其修改为——
\usepackage{CJKutf8}
\begin{document}
\begin{CJK}{UTF8}{gbsn}
然后再找到“\end{document}”这一行,将其修改为——
\end{CJK}
\end{document}
用命令:
sed -i -e ‘s,begin{document},usepackage{CJKutf8}\n\\begin{document}\n\\begin{CJK}{UTF8}{gbsn},’ refman.tex
sed -i -e ‘s,end{document},end{CJK}\n\\end{document},’ refman.tex
让Latex显示markdown中的图片:
@image xxx_arch.eps “People image” width=\textwidth